Introduction & Scope (Paragraphs 1-11)

Scope of HKSA 720 (Revised)

Deals with auditor's responsibilities relating to other information (financial or non-financial) included in an entity's annual report.

Key Point: The auditor's opinion on the financial statements does not cover the other information.

Exclusions from Scope

  • Preliminary announcements of financial information
  • Securities offering documents (including prospectuses)

Purpose of the Standard

To ensure the auditor reads and considers other information because material inconsistencies may indicate a misstatement of the financial statements or the other information itself, undermining credibility.

Effective Date

Effective for audits of financial statements for periods ending on or after 15 December 2016.

Objectives (Paragraphs 12-12)

Auditor's Objectives

Having read the other information, the auditor's objectives are:

  1. Consider whether there is a material inconsistency between the other information and the financial statements.
  2. Consider whether there is a material inconsistency between the other information and the auditor's knowledge obtained in the audit.
  3. Respond appropriately when such material inconsistencies appear to exist or when the auditor becomes aware that other information appears to be materially misstated.
  4. Report in accordance with this HKSA.

Definitions (Paragraphs 12(a)-12(c))

Annual Report (12(a))

A document (or combination) prepared annually to provide owners with information on operations, financial results, and financial position. It contains or accompanies the financial statements and auditor's report.

Misstatement of the Other Information (12(b))

Exists when the other information is incorrectly stated or otherwise misleading (including omission or obscuring of necessary information).

Other Information (12(c))

Financial or non-financial information (other than financial statements and auditor's report) included in an entity's annual report.

Obtaining the Other Information (Paragraph 13)

Requirements for Obtaining

The auditor shall:

  • Determine through discussion with management which document(s) comprise the annual report and the planned manner and timing of issuance.
  • Make arrangements to obtain the final version in a timely manner, preferably before the date of the auditor's report.
  • Request written representation from management when some documents will not be available until after the auditor's report date, confirming they will provide the final version when available.
Important: The auditor is not precluded from dating or issuing the auditor's report if some or all other information has not been obtained.

Reading & Considering the Other Information (Paragraphs 14-15)

Reading and Considering (14)

The auditor shall read the other information and:

  • Consider material inconsistency with the financial statements by comparing selected amounts or items.
  • Consider material inconsistency with the auditor's knowledge obtained in the audit.

Alertness for Other Indications (15)

While reading, the auditor shall remain alert for indications that other information not related to the financial statements or auditor's knowledge appears to be materially misstated.

Professional Skepticism: The auditor must recognize that management may be overly optimistic and be alert to information inconsistent with the financial statements or audit knowledge.

Responding to Misstatements (Paragraphs 16-20)

When a Material Inconsistency Appears to Exist (16)

The auditor shall discuss the matter with management and, if necessary, perform other procedures to conclude whether a material misstatement of the other information or financial statements exists.

When a Material Misstatement Exists (17-19)

  • Request management to correct the other information.
  • If management refuses, communicate with those charged with governance and request correction.
  • If still not corrected, consider implications for the auditor's report or withdrawal from the engagement (where possible).

Post-Report Date Misstatements (19)

If corrected, perform necessary procedures. If not corrected, take appropriate action to bring the matter to users' attention.

Material Misstatement in Financial Statements (20)

If a material misstatement in the financial statements is identified, respond in accordance with other HKSAs.

Reporting (Paragraphs 21-24)

When to Include 'Other Information' Section (21)

The auditor's report shall include a separate section with a heading 'Other Information' when:

  • For a listed entity: the auditor has obtained or expects to obtain the other information.
  • For an entity other than a listed entity: the auditor has obtained some or all of the other information.

Content of the Section (22)

Must include:

  • Statement that management is responsible for the other information.
  • Identification of other information obtained (and expected to be obtained for listed entities).
  • Statement that the auditor's opinion does not cover the other information.
  • Description of the auditor's responsibilities.
  • Statement about uncorrected material misstatements, if any.

Modified Opinions (23-24)

When the opinion is qualified or adverse, consider the implications for the statement required in paragraph 22(e). If a disclaimer of opinion is issued, the auditor's report does not include the Other Information section.

Documentation (Paragraph 25)

Documentation Requirements

In addressing HKSA 230, the auditor shall include in the audit documentation:

  • Documentation of the procedures performed under this HKSA.
  • The final version of the other information on which the auditor has performed the required work.
